Where is the Hetterich family from?

You can see how Hetterich families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Hetterich family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1871 and 1920. The most Hetterich families were found in USA in 1880. In 1891 there were 5 Hetterich families living in London. This was 100% of all the recorded Hetterich's in United Kingdom. London had the highest population of Hetterich families in 1891.

What is the average Hetterich lifespan?

Between 1965 and 2003, in the United States, Hetterich life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1991, and highest in 1980. The average life expectancy for Hetterich in 1965 was 73, and 81 in 2003.

An unusually short lifespan might indicate that your Hetterich ancestors lived in harsh conditions. A short lifespan might also indicate health problems that were once prevalent in your family.
